Bailey, a rescued dog, travels almost 17 kilometers to return to the shelter after getting lost


A female dog that had just been adopted by her new family got lost and traveled almost 17 kilometers to reach the shelter that had previously rescued her, in El Paso, Texas, in the United States.

The picture of Bailey, The name given to him at the animal shelter, he went viral after his face was captured on a doorbell camera at the establishment at the end of his long journey.

Before being adopted, Bailey spent several months in the shelter, where she won the hearts of all the collaborators, according to the Infobae medium.

What happened to Bailey?

After she disappeared, her new family and people from the shelter came out looking for her and put up posters all over town. But the days passed and the hope of seeing her again was fading.

However, in the middle of the night, Bailey surprised by appearing on his own at the shelter and ringing the doorbell.

According to various media, it is not known how Bailey found his way back to his old home.

“I panic. I said, ‘who’s coming at 1.47 am?’ On her camera, Bailey is seen running around, waiting for someone to pick her up. One of our collaborators yelled ‘Bailey’ and started jumping for joy”, told the press Loretta Hydefounder of the El Paso animal shelter.

They immediately let her in and gave her food. It is presumed that she spent at least three days without eating and hardly sleeping.

From the shelter they called the adoptive family, who continued to search for her.

At the moment, Bailey is back at home.
